In Russia, work is underway to create the world's first gene therapy drug capable of slowing aging at the cellular level. It involves targeting the RAGE gene, whose activation is what triggers the aging processes in cells.
The development was described by Deputy Minister of Science and Higher Education Denis Sekirinsky. According to him, the idea is to suppress the activity of this gene: in that case, cells will be able to maintain a "young" state for longer.
The project is being carried out at the Institute of Aging Biology and Medicine as part of the national project "New Health Preservation Technologies." If the development proves successful, it could become the first in the world in its class.
The technology belongs to the field of gene therapy, one of the most promising approaches in the fight against aging. It targets not the symptoms, but the very mechanism of age-related changes.
The development was announced at a conference in Saransk dedicated to the medicine of healthy longevity. Scientists, doctors, and government representatives are taking part, discussing new methods for preventing age-related diseases and the introduction of advanced technologies into healthcare.
